Because I Am Staying In

The Getty Museum tweeted a challenge to recreate a piece of art using the objects at hand. During the weeks between March 31, 2020 and April 12, 2020 while we self-isolated at home I made 48 recreations. I posted every remake with the phrase BECAUSE I AM STAYING IN in an effort to support flattening the curve. The Getty retweeted some of them and Buzzfeed included one in their coverage.

I found this “re-creational” diversion totally engrossing and thrilling. I totally forgot the tension of Covid-19 news for those moments and was happy to have my poetry brain, which was on pause after handing in my MFA thesis draft, experience a trill of novelty.

I gave myself a ten minute rule to assemble these tableaus, which I pretty much stuck to. Shooting and uploading them on my old phone was more time-consuming! Thanks to everyone who responded online with enthusiasm for this ridiculous impulse. It was a silly and surprising way to connect with so many people.
